- [ ] **Step 7: Breaker override escrow.** After sealing the signing keys for the Tallgrove upstream API circuit breaker, confirm the support team can force the breaker open during a full outage. The override bundle lives in the sealed escrow drawer and is useless without its unlock phrase. Two ceremony witnesses must initial this step before proceeding. The escrow bundle is decrypted with the recovery passphrase that follows.

vault phrase of kahip-kahop = holath-quenmir

**Ticket: Sockpress vault locked again**

Hey — the config vault for Sockpress got auto-locked during the release freeze, so nobody can tweak the websocket compression settings. We still owe a decision on permessage-deflate vs. raw frames for the mobile clients. To unseal the vault and ship the toggle, use the recovery passphrase below.

vault phrase of bagaf-kajeg = jorath-feniel-briir-siliel-ralix

## Break-Glass: Fleet Fuel Report (Project Haulstone)

The Haulstone fuel-usage report aggregates nightly from depot telemetry. If aggregation fails twice, the report store locks to prevent partial data. Do not edit rows manually. Break-glass applies only when the weekly report deadline is at risk. Unlock, re-run aggregation, then note the event for eng sync. Unlock requires the passphrase below.

unlock words, yawig-kagef: gordor-holvan-ulaael-pramir-ulaiel-tamdor

Runbook: Fenwick crash-report pipeline. When the ingest lag alarm fires, first check the symbolication workers — they stall if the dSYM cache fills. Drain the backlog queue only after confirming the store is writable; draining first loses reports. All thresholds and worker counts come from the deployed configuration, reproduced here.

config for kafof-bawef:
holath:
  log_level: debug
  metrics_host: metrics.holath.qorvelsys.internal
  pin: 2191
  pool_size: 32

## Changelog — Quotaforge 3.1

Renamed `TENANT_RATE_CAP` to `TENANT_QUOTA_LIMIT`. Old key removed; no fallback. On-call: if quota enforcement fails after deploy, check env files first — stale key name is the usual culprit. Per-tenant quotas now evaluated per minute, not per hour; multiply old values by 60 when migrating. Quota ledger writes are unchanged. Enforcement daemon restarts cleanly on SIGHUP after env edits. The ledger writer still authenticates with its shared credential, set on the line immediately following the quota limit.

env line for fafof-fahag: LEDGER_TOKEN5=f8790